About

Brittani Senser is a Licensed Independent Clinical Social Worker in Minnesota (MN LICSW 26563) with nine years of clinical experience. She works with people facing a range of concerns, including stress, anxiety, trauma and abuse, grief, self-esteem, coaching, addictions, and family issues.

Her clinical training and practice have involved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T), and work addressing chemical dependency. She has also supported adult students as they navigate the transition from education to the challenges of post-education life.

Brittani is certified as a Youth Suicide Preventionalist by the American Association of Suicidology. In her spare time she develops curriculum for youth suicide prevention for ages 10-24 and administers trainings for parents, mental health professionals, teachers, and students.

She believes each person has strengths that can help them overcome challenges and that many people benefit from guidance to find practical tools for success. Brittani recognizes the courage it takes to begin therapy and supports clients who take that first step toward change.
